Abstract

A truly intelligent autonomous mobile robot should have a common representation model, which can simultaneously satisfy low level navigational capabilities, medium level self-referencing capabilities, high level motion planning capabilities, and the ability to be controlled through the Internet. In this presentation, the issues for a truly intelligent autonomous mobile robot is first addressed. The issues for supervisory control of an intelligent autonomous mobile robot through the Internet will also be discussed. Finally, the opportunities for the application of intelligent autonomous mobile robot is described. Video presentation to demonstrate the feasibility of these techniques is also included.
